-->"[[MemeticMutation Simples!]]"

''Compare The Meerkat.Com'' is a series of adverts and a website designed as nothing more than ViralMarketing for an insurance website (comparethemarket.com). The adverts all take a similar format, Aleksandr Orlov the Meerkat will remind viewers that his website is for comparing meerkats, and not for comparing markets and urge viewers to check they have the correct URL.
